Angiogenesis Inhibition by Bee Venom in Rat Aortic Model

Message:
Abstract:
Background And Objective
Angiogenesis- formation of new blood vessels from former ones- is an essential process in development. Bee venom has been used to cure diverse ills for many years. In the present research the inhibitory effect of bee venom on angiogenesis has been investigated in a wistar rat aortic model.
Materials And Methods
Rat''s aorta was cut into 1 mm pieces and cultured in collagen matrix. After observation of the first sprouting of angiogenesis، the samples were divided into control and experimental groups. Experimental groups were treated with bee venom in concentration 10، 20، 30، 40، 50، 60، 70 µg/ml. Angiogenesis was investigated and photographed by invert microscope. Numbers and lengths of vessels were measured by Image J software. Data were analyzed by SPSS software and ANOVA & TUKEY in significant level (p<0. 05).
Results
Lengths average and numbers of blood vessels in experimental groups at concentration of 10، 20، 30µg/ml in comparison to control group showed any significant changes (p>0. 05). length average and numbers of blood vessels in experimental groups with 40، 50، 60، 70 µg/ml concentration showed a significant decrease in comparison to control group)p<0. 05).
Conclusion
The proper concentrations of BV inhibits angiogenesis. So it can be considered in studies of cancer and pathological conditions associated with angiogenesis.
